As of , an estimate of 9,441 residents live in 25508 with a median age of 44.1 years. 21.84 percent of the population is under the age of 18, and 21.14 percent of the population is at least 65 years of age. 35.47 percent of the residents in 25508 is currently married, and 20.83 percent of the population has never been married.
The monthly median household income in 25508 is $5,867.50. The monthly median housing costs for residents in 25508 is approximately $543. The median household spends about 9.25 percent of their income on housing.
